Job description

Position Summary: The Sr. Strategic Procurement is responsible for developing and executing sourcing and supplier strategies that support the development, manufacturing, and distribution of dental products. This role manages complex categories and strategic supplier relationships to deliver cost savings, strengthen supply continuity, improve quality, and drive innovation. The position also advances procurement transformation through the implementation of AI-enabled tools, automation, advanced analytics, and other technologies that generate measurable business value.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Develop and execute sourcing and category strategies for materials and components supporting dental product development and manufacturing.

  • Lead supplier selection, competitive bidding, contract negotiations, cost analysis, and total cost of ownership evaluations.

  • Prepare and execute RFPs, reverse auctions, and other sourcing events.

  • Build strong, accountable relationships with strategic suppliers and cross-functional stakeholders.

  • Monitor supplier quality, delivery, cost, capacity, service, compliance, and overall performance.

  • Lead supplier business reviews, performance improvement plans, issue resolution, and escalations.

  • Identify and mitigate supply risks, including sole-source dependencies, capacity constraints, long lead times, and business interruptions.

  • Partner with Quality and Regulatory Affairs on supplier qualification, audits, corrective actions, change control, and documentation.

  • Maintain the Approved Supplier List, supplier files, scorecards, ERP records, and annual supplier risk assessments.

  • Represent Procurement on New Product Introduction projects, develop sourcing plans, manage deliverables, and ensure milestones are achieved.

  • Identify and deliver cost savings, cost avoidance, and value improvement opportunities to achieve annual targets.

  • Analyze supplier spend and market trends to identify consolidation opportunities, sourcing leverage, and provide pricing and budget guidance.

  • Resolve invoice discrepancies, price holds, receipt holds, and other supplier payment issues.

  • Lead cross-functional meetings and influence decisions without formal authority.

  • Champion procurement transformation through process improvement, AI-enabled tools, automation, advanced analytics, and other technologies.

  • Mentor colleagues on share best practices and contribute to skills development.

  • Travel up to 10%, primarily to local company and supplier locations.

Education and Experience:

  • Bachelor’s degree required, preferably in Supply Chain or related field, plus a minimum of 5 years of relevant work experience OR

  • High school diploma or equivalent plus minimum of 8 years of relevant work experience required.

  • Experience must include: success in leading complex sourcing initiatives and supplier negotiations; supporting NPI initiatives; and working in a highly regulated manufacturing environment required, preferably FDA regulated

  • Experience leading procurement or supply-chain transformation initiatives, including the adoption of AI, automation, advanced analytics, or other emerging technologies highly preferred.

  • ASCM/APICS certification highly preferred, specifically in Transformation for Supply Chain.

Skills and Abilities:

  • Proven ability to influence cross-functional stakeholders and lead initiatives without formal authority required.

  • Demonstrated expertise in negotiating complex agreements and building productive, long-term supplier relationships required.

  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ills, including cost modeling, total cost of ownership analysis, and supplier performance measurement required.

  • Advanced proficiency in Microsoft Office, particularly Excel, Word, and Outlook required.

  • Proficiency with ERP systems required; Oracle experience preferred.

  • Ability to manage multiple priorities and adapt effectively in a fast-paced, changing environment required.

  • Strong written and verbal communication skills in English, with the ability to communicate effectively across organizational levels required.
